G. Emlen Hall is a scholar working on Astronomy and Astrophysics, Molecular Biology and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, G. Emlen Hall has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 442 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Astronomy and Astrophysics, 7 papers in Molecular Biology and 5 papers in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in G. Emlen Hall’s work include Ionosphere and magnetosphere dynamics (12 papers), Archaeology and Natural History (5 papers) and Solar and Space Plasma Dynamics (5 papers). G. Emlen Hall is often cited by papers focused on Ionosphere and magnetosphere dynamics (12 papers), Archaeology and Natural History (5 papers) and Solar and Space Plasma Dynamics (5 papers). G. Emlen Hall collaborates with scholars based in United States and Canada. G. Emlen Hall's co-authors include A. H. Manson, C. E. Meek, J. W. MacDougall, D. R. Moorcroft, William F. Thompson, A. K. Weissinger, George C. Allen, Steven Spiker, J.‐P. St.‐Maurice and K. Hayashi and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res, The Plant Cell and Geophysical Research Letters.
